What is Car Key Coding?
Car key coding refers to the process of programming a car Key Coding Near Me to run with a particular vehicle. Unlike standard car Keys Program Near Me, which just needed to turn in the ignition, modern-day keys are geared up with electronic components that interact with the vehicle’s immobilizer system. The coding procedure guarantees that only the properly programmed key can start the engine, thereby boosting general security.

Types of Car Keys
Car keys have progressed substantially throughout the years. Below are some common kinds of keys along with quick descriptions.
Type of KeyDescriptionStandard KeysBasic metal keys that are cut to fit the vehicle’s lock.Transponder KeysKeys which contain a chip which communicates with the vehicle’s immobilizer.Smart KeysAdvanced keys geared up with fobs that utilize distance sensing units for keyless entry.Key FobsRemote devices that can lock/unlock doors and may likewise begin the engine.Emergency KeysSpare keys that can be used to open the driver’s side door when essential.The Car Key Coding Process
The Car Keys Programming key coding process usually includes several actions. While the steps might differ based on the vehicle’s make and design, the following offers a general guideline.
Step 1: Acquiring a Replacement KeyThe initial step is to get a new or replacement key. This key action can be done through a car dealership, locksmith, or after-market provider.Step 2: Gathering Necessary InformationOwners typically require to supply crucial information such as the Vehicle Identification Number (VIN), evidence of ownership, and in some cases, existing keys.Step 3: Programming the KeyOnce the new key remains in hand, programming can commence. This can typically be done through:A vehicle diagnostic toolA transponder key programmerFollowing specific manufacturer-provided directions.Step 4: Testing the KeyAfter programming, the key needs to be tested to guarantee that it can unlock the doors and begin the engine.Typical Methods of Key Coding
Key coding can be accomplished through numerous methods, which can include:
Onboard Programming: Many newer cars allow for key programming straight through the car’s onboard computer system.Diagnostic Equipment: Professional locksmith professionals or dealerships typically utilize specialized diagnostic devices to move the necessary code information to the new key.Key Cloning: This approach includes producing a replicate of an existing key by copying the information from the initial to a brand-new key.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)What should I do if I lose my only car key?

Can I program my own car key?
Many automobiles allow owners to program keys on their own utilizing specific directions supplied in the owner’s handbook. Nevertheless, for more modern-day cars, you may require a specialized tool or professional support.
Just how much does it cost to code a car key?
The cost of coding a car key can differ commonly depending on aspects such as the vehicle’s make and design, the type of key, and where you choose the service. Typically, rates can vary from ₤ 50 to ₤ 200 or more.
How can I tell if my key is coded correctly?
The finest method to identify if your key is properly coded is to just try utilizing it. If the key successfully unlocks the car and starts the engine, it is functioning as meant.
What takes place if I attempt to utilize an uncoded key?
If you try to begin your vehicle with an uncoded key, the car’s immobilizer system will prevent the engine from starting, thus protecting the vehicle from theft.
